Thermal Analysis
TA Instruments Q800 Dynamic Mechanical Analysis (DMA)
- Analysis of mechanical properties as a function of time, temperature and frequency.
- Can be used to analyze for example stiffness, elasticity and damping.
- Maximum force 18 N
- Temperature range -150 - 600 °C
30 - 80 °C with variable humidity 10 - 80 %
- Frequency range 0.01 - 200 Hz

AMI-200 Characterization system
- Temperature programmed measurements at atmospheric pressure for characterization of solid materials
- Temperature-programmed desorption (TPD)
- Temperature-programmed reduction (TPR)
- Temperature-programmed oxidation (TPO)
- Temperature-programmed surface reaction (TPSR)
- Pulse chemisorption
- Temperature range -50 - 900 °C
- Mass spectrometer for analysis of outflow gases

Perkin-Elmer Pyris 1 TGA Thermogravimetric Analyzer

- Thermogravimetric measurements for solids at ambient pressure in various atmospheres
- High-sensitivity balance, high-temperature furnace (up to 1500 °C)
- Platinum and alumina sample holders available
- Heating rate from 1 °C/min up to 50 °C/min, rapid cooling (1000 °C to 40 °C in 15 min)
- Rapid gas switching possibility during the measurement

Perkin-Elmer Diamond DSC Differential Scanning Calorimetry

- Ambient and low-temperature DSC measurements
- Liquid nitrogen cooling system
- High accuracy
- Heating rates from 5 °C/min up to 40 °C/min
- Solid and liquid materials
